                               RESOLUTION

 
   Providing for consideration of the bill (H.R. 8800) to authorize 
  appropriations for fiscal year 2027 for military activities of the 
   Department of Defense, for military construction, and for defense 
activities of the Department of Energy, to prescribe military personnel 
 strengths for such fiscal year, and for other purposes; providing for 
    consideration of the bill (H.R. 8595) making appropriations for 
 national security, Department of State, and related programs for the 
    fiscal year ending September 30, 2027, and for other purposes; 
 providing for consideration of the bill (H.R. 8884) to amend title II 
 of the Social Security Act to reauthorize demonstration authority for 
 the disability insurance program; providing for consideration of the 
resolution (H. Res. 1383) commemorating the one-year anniversary of the 
  enactment of the Working Families Tax Cuts; and for other purposes.

    Resolved, That at any time after adoption of this resolution the 
Speaker may, pursuant to clause 2(b) of rule XVIII, declare the House 
resolved into the Committee of the Whole House on the state of the 
Union for consideration of the bill (H.R. 8800) to authorize 
appropriations for fiscal year 2027 for military activities of the 
Department of Defense, for military construction, and for defense 
activities of the Department of Energy, to prescribe military personnel 
strengths for such fiscal year, and for other purposes. The first 
reading of the bill shall be dispensed with. All points of order 
against consideration of the bill are waived. General debate shall be 
confined to the bill and amendments specified in this section and shall 
not exceed one hour equally divided and controlled by the chair and 
ranking minority member of the Committee on Armed Services or their 
respective designees. After general debate the bill shall be considered 
for amendment under the five-minute rule. In lieu of the amendment in 
the nature of a substitute recommended by the Committee on Armed 
Services now printed in the bill, an amendment in the nature of a 
substitute consisting of the text of Rules Committee Print 119-33 shall 
be considered as adopted in the House and in the Committee of the 
Whole. The bill, as amended, shall be considered as the original bill 
for the purpose of further amendment under the five-minute rule and 
shall be considered as read. All points of order against provisions in 
the bill, as amended, are waived.
    Sec. 2.  (a) No further amendment to H.R. 8800, as amended, shall 
be in order except those printed in part A of the report of the 
Committee on Rules accompanying this resolution, amendments en bloc 
described in section 3 of this resolution, and pro forma amendments 
described in section 4 of this resolution.
    (b) Each further amendment printed in part A of the report of the 
Committee on Rules shall be considered only in the order printed in the 
report, may be offered only by a Member designated in the report, shall 
be considered as read, shall be debatable for the time specified in the 
report equally divided and controlled by the proponent and an opponent, 
shall not be subject to amendment except as provided by section 4 of 
this resolution, and shall not be subject to a demand for division of 
the question in the House or in the Committee of the Whole.
    (c) All points of order against further amendments printed in part 
A of the report of the Committee on Rules or against amendments en bloc 
described in section 3 of this resolution are waived.
    Sec. 3.  It shall be in order at any time for the chair of the 
Committee on Armed Services or his designee to offer amendments en bloc 
consisting of further amendments printed in part A of the report of the 
Committee on Rules accompanying this resolution not earlier disposed 
of. Amendments en bloc offered pursuant to this section shall be 
considered as read, shall be debatable for 40 minutes equally divided 
and controlled by the chair and ranking minority member of the 
Committee on Armed Services or their respective designees, shall not be 
subject to amendment except as provided by section 4 of this 
resolution, and shall not be subject to a demand for division of the 
question in the House or in the Committee of the Whole.
    Sec. 4.  During consideration of H.R. 8800 for amendment, the chair 
and ranking minority member of the Committee on Armed Services or their 
respective designees may offer up to 10 pro forma amendments each at 
any point for the purpose of debate.
    Sec. 5.  At the conclusion of consideration of H.R. 8800 for 
amendment the Committee shall rise and report the bill, as amended, to 
the House with such further amendments as may have been adopted. The 
previous question shall be considered as ordered on the bill, as 
amended, and on any further amendment thereto to final passage without 
intervening motion except one motion to recommit.
    Sec. 6.  At any time after adoption of this resolution the Speaker 
may, pursuant to clause 2(b) of rule XVIII, declare the House resolved 
into the Committee of the Whole House on the state of the Union for 
consideration of the bill (H.R. 8595) making appropriations for 
national security, Department of State, and related programs for the 
fiscal year ending September 30, 2027, and for other purposes. The 
first reading of the bill shall be dispensed with. All points of order 
against consideration of the bill are waived. General debate shall be 
confined to the bill and shall not exceed one hour equally divided and 
controlled by the chair and ranking minority member of the Committee on 
Appropriations or their respective designees. After general debate the 
bill shall be considered for amendment under the five-minute rule. The 
bill shall be considered as read. Points of order against provisions in 
the bill for failure to comply with clause 2 or clause 5(a) of rule XXI 
are waived.
    Sec. 7.  (a) No amendment to H.R. 8595 shall be in order except 
those printed in part B of the report of the Committee on Rules 
accompanying this resolution, amendments en bloc described in section 8 
of this resolution, and pro forma amendments described in section 9 of 
this resolution.
    (b) Each amendment printed in part B of the report of the Committee 
on Rules shall be considered only in the order printed in the report, 
may be offered only by a Member designated in the report, shall be 
considered as read, shall be debatable for the time specified in the 
report equally divided and controlled by the proponent and an opponent, 
shall not be subject to amendment except as provided by section 9 of 
this resolution, and shall not be subject to a demand for division of 
the question in the House or in the Committee of the Whole.
    (c) All points of order against amendments printed in part B of the 
report of the Committee on Rules or against amendments en bloc 
described in section 8 of this resolution are waived.
    Sec. 8.  It shall be in order at any time for the chair of the 
Committee on Appropriations or his designee to offer amendments en bloc 
consisting of amendments printed in part B of the report of the 
Committee on Rules accompanying this resolution not earlier disposed 
of. Amendments en bloc offered pursuant to this section shall be 
considered as read, shall be debatable for 20 minutes equally divided 
and controlled by the chair and ranking minority member of the 
Committee on Appropriations or their respective designees, shall not be 
subject to amendment except as provided by section 9 of this 
resolution, and shall not be subject to a demand for division of the 
question in the House or in the Committee of the Whole.
    Sec. 9.  During consideration of H.R. 8595 for amendment, the chair 
and ranking minority member of the Committee on Appropriations or their 
respective designees may offer up to 10 pro forma amendments each at 
any point for the purpose of debate.
    Sec. 10.  At the conclusion of consideration of H.R. 8595 for 
amendment the Committee shall rise and report the bill to the House 
with such amendments as may have been adopted. The previous question 
shall be considered as ordered on the bill and amendments thereto to 
final passage without intervening motion except one motion to recommit.
    Sec. 11.  Upon adoption of this resolution it shall be in order to 
consider in the House the bill (H.R. 8884) to amend title II of the 
Social Security Act to reauthorize demonstration authority for the 
disability insurance program. All points of order against consideration 
of the bill are waived. In lieu of the amendment in the nature of a 
substitute recommended by the Committee on Ways and Means now printed 
in the bill, an amendment in the nature of a substitute consisting of 
the text of Rules Committee Print 119-34 shall be considered as 
adopted. The bill, as amended, shall be considered as read. All points 
of order against provisions in the bill, as amended, are waived. The 
previous question shall be considered as ordered on the bill, as 
amended, and on any further amendment thereto, to final passage without 
intervening motion except: (1) one hour of debate equally divided and 
controlled by the chair and ranking minority member of the Committee on 
Ways and Means or their respective designees; and (2) one motion to 
recommit.
    Sec. 12.  Upon adoption of this resolution it shall be in order 
without intervention of any point of order to consider in the House the 
resolution (H. Res. 1383) commemorating the one-year anniversary of the 
enactment of the Working Families Tax Cuts. The amendment to the 
preamble printed in part C of the report of the Committee on Rules 
accompanying this resolution shall be considered as adopted. The 
resolution, as amended, shall be considered as read. The previous 
question shall be considered as ordered on the resolution and preamble, 
as amended, to adoption without intervening motion or demand for 
division of the question except one hour of debate equally divided and 
controlled by the chair and ranking minority member of the Committee on 
Ways and Means or their respective designees.
    Sec. 13.  House Resolution 1377 is laid on the table.
    Sec. 14.  In the engrossment of H.R. 8800, the Clerk shall--
    (a) add the text of S. 1383, as passed by the House, as new matter 
at the end of H.R. 8800;
    (b) assign appropriate designations to provisions within the 
engrossment;
    (c) conform cross-references and provisions for short titles within 
the engrossment; and
    (d) be authorized to make technical corrections, to include 
corrections in spelling, punctuation, page and line numbering, section 
numbering, and insertion of appropriate headings within the 
engrossment.
